If you’re trying to get out of debt then you need to spend time creating a budget. To make keep track of a budget you should have a budget planner.

You might think that you can keep track of everything in your head, and maybe you can, but having a printable budget planner in front of you helps to greatly visualize where your money is going.

11 Free Budget Planners to Help Organize Your Finances

Each of these free budget planners will help you work on getting out of debt because you will not overspend on things when you don’t have the money.

The goal of a budget isn’t to limit the things you can do with your life but to ensure that you are able to do more things because you have an understanding of your money situation.

A Simple Budget Planner Is Better Than No Budget Planner

When people hear others talk about budget planners they think of something that is complicated. Even if you don’t want to print out any of the budget planners above, you can simply use Google Docs to create an online budget planner that you have access to all of the time.

This is how my wife and I handle our budget.

We track the incoming money from our online businesses and have the exact dates that our bills are supposed to come out. We have 3 bank accounts:

  1. Mine where the bills I manage come out
  2. Hers where the bills she manage come out
  3. Shared where we use for future savings, entertainment, and emergencies

Using a budget planner was the exact thing that turned me from clueless finance guy that was always stressing about money, to someone that understands where every single penny is either coming or going.

Answers the question, 'Where does the money go?'

First, at its simplest, a budget is the tool you use to know if you will spend more than you earn. To create a budget, you project your income and then deduct your estimated expenses. The budget calculator makes this calculation a snap. Just provide values for the pertinent inputs and click on the 'Calc' button. That's all there is to it. Check out the Summary section for the results.

If the income is higher than the expenses, congratulate yourself. You're at least on the right track. However, if the expenses are higher than the income, then eventually some adjustments will need to be made.

You might be saying, 'I don't need a budget calculator to know if I'm spending more than I'm earning.' That's probably is right. But there's another, even more, important use for a budget.

Budgets help us reach our goals.

The budget calculator shows the percentage each category is relative to total expenses. If you have a goal to save for the down payment for a home, the calculator will show you where you can consider making adjustments so that you can reach your goal.

What is a Budget Calculator Used For?

Simply put, a budget calculator let's you answer that famous question, 'Where did all the money go?'. Our Budget Calculator also calculates expense groups as a percentage of total expenses. It may be reasonable to have 30% of your expenses go to 'Shelter'. It probably would not be such a good idea if your 'Recreation Expenses' were also 30%.
